About
Iain Potter is a damages expert and academic based in Singapore. He specialises in the quantification of damages and contentious business valuations, working at the intersection of accounting, law, and finance.
Since relocating from London to Singapore in 2014, Iain has been appointed as an expert in over 100 cases across six continents, testifying before courts and arbitral tribunals on dozens of occasions. He has been engaged in ICC, LCIA, SIAC, PCA, JCAA, and AIAC arbitral proceedings, as well as before national courts in Singapore, the UK, Australia, Thailand, Malaysia, Nepal, Cyprus, and the Abu Dhabi Global Market Courts, among others.
Alongside his consulting practice, Iain is a member of the adjunct faculty at the National University of Singapore’s Business School, where he co-developed and teaches a forensic accounting course covering investigation techniques and damages quantification. He is currently pursuing a PhD at the University of Leicester Law School, researching the extent to which awards of damages reflect risk and uncertainty.
Iain is recognised as a Thought Leader by Lexology Index and is ranked in Band 1 by Chambers & Partners.
